Here Beside the Rising Tide
- Jerry Garcia, the Grateful Dead, and an American Awakening
- By: Jim Newton
- Narrated by: Jim Newton
- Length: 15 hrs and 36 mins
- Unabridged
-
Overall
-
Performance
-
Story
In early 1960’s Palo Alto, Jerry Garcia randomly opened a dictionary to a fable in which an appreciative soul repays the generosity of a traveler by delivering him a fortune, a “gift of the grateful dead.” After a traumatic car accident that injured him and killed a close friend, Garcia had recently resolved to build the life he wanted, which meant making music. He had practiced relentlessly and caromed across the northern California folk and bluegrass scene, gathered up some fellow musicians and formed a band. Now they had their name.

Bogart and Huston
- Their Lives, Their Adventures, and the Classic Movies They Made Together
- By: Nat Segaloff
- Narrated by: Nat Segaloff
- Length: 6 hrs and 30 mins
- Unabridged
-
Overall
-
Performance
-
Story
From 1941 to 1953, director John Huston and actor Humphrey Bogart made one classic film after another, from The Maltese Falcon to The African Queen. Here is the story of their close but combative friendship that produced some of the best movies ever made. Their friendship was as dramatic as any of their movies. It survived nine marriages, a world war, the blacklist, leeches, alcohol, and Jack L. Warner.
